ChoiceLab Project Guide

Students will develop a responsible decision-making framework by analyzing a virtual case study and defining personalized decision criteria. By the end of three sessions, they will evaluate options and justify choices based on consequences, values, and goals.

Responsible decision-making empowers students to make thoughtful choices in academic, social, and personal contexts. This lesson builds critical thinking by guiding students through real-world scenarios and self-reflection, equipping them with transferable skills.
